Prepare Ingredients:
Ensure both the cream cheese and butter are softened to room temperature for easy blending and a smooth consistency.
Mix the Base:
In a m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ese and butter together on medium speed until light and fluffy, about 2–3 minutes.
Add Sugar and Flavoring:
Gradually add the powdered sugar, one cup at a time, mixing on low speed to avoid splattering.
Add the vanilla extract and salt, then increase the speed to medium-high and beat until the frosting is smooth and creamy.
Adjust Consistency:
If the frosting is too thick, add 1–2 teaspoons of milk or heavy cream to thin it. If it’s too thin, add a bit more powdered sugar.
Use Immediately or Store:
Spread or pipe the frosting onto your baked goods. If not using immediately, store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week. Allow it to come to room temperature and re-whip before using.
